Meaning of
par-e-taous
पर-ए-ताऊस • پر طاؤس
English
peacock feather; symbol of beauty
Hindi
मोर पंख; सुंदरता का प्रतीक
Urdu
مور پنکھ; خوبصورتی کی علامت
Origin
Persian
Nuance
The peacock feather, with its vibrant colors and delicate structure, evokes a sense of beauty and grace. In poetry, it often symbolizes the allure and elegance of nature, capturing the imagination with its intricate patterns.
Poetic Usage
Poets use 'par-e-taous' to evoke images of ethereal beauty and elegance. It can represent the delicate balance of nature's artistry or the fleeting moments of beauty in life.
